SUPERVISORY SECURITY SPECIALIST


Qualifications:
In order to qualify, you must meet the specialized experience requirements described in the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Qualification Standards for General Schedule Positions, Administrative and Management Positions. SPECIALIZED
Experience:
Applicants must have at least one (1) year of specialized experience at the next lower broadband NH-02, equivalent to the next lower grade of GS-11 or equivalent in the Federal Service. Experience must include implementing and administering specialized information protection and security programs in support of major agency, defense acquisition, and/or intelligence programs. Knowledge of Security Forces Support Staff, Intelligence and Investigations, Operations, Logistics, Plans and Programs functions. FEDERAL TIME-IN-GRADE (TIG) REQUIREMENT FOR GENERAL SCHEDULE (GS) POSITIONS:
Merit promotion applicants must meet applicable time-in- grade requirements to be considered eligible. One year at the NH-02 (GS-11) level is required to meet the time-in-grade requirements for the NH-03 (GS-12 level). TIG applies if you are in a current GS position or held a GS position within the previous 52 weeks. K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ES (KSAs):
Your qualifications will be evaluated on the basis of your level of knowledge, skills, abilities and/or competencies in the following areas:
1. Knowledge of Air Force Security Forces Staff, Intelligence and Investigations, Operations, Logistics and Plans and Programs functions. 2. Knowledge of safety and security regulations, practices, and procedures, personnel management, and EEO regulations. 3. Ability to plan, organize, and direct the functions and mentor, motivate, and appraise the squadron through subordinate supervisors. 4. Ability to analyze, plan, coordinate, and adjust work operations of multiple mission sets to meet requirements and objectives with available resources. Knowledge of the tactics, techniques, and procedures necessary for preparation and response to catastrophic events, enemy attacks, and related threats to installations. 5. Ability to formulate and effectively implement special operating requirements, methods, and procedures for enforcing specialized personnel access controls and preventing unauthorized access to areas where stringent security requirements are enforced. 6. Ability to supervise, mentor, motivate, appraise, and work with subordinate supervisors and nonsupervisory employees. 7. Ability to communicate both orally and in writing, clearly, concisely, and with technical accuracy. PART-TIME OR UNPAID
Experience:
Credit will be given for appropriate unpaid and or part-time work. You must clearly identify the duties and responsibilities in each position held and the total number of hours per week. VOLUNTEER WORK
Experience:
Ref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service Programs (i.e.,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community; student and social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ge and skills that can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
